I want Jenkins to stay. I always dislike when players who have been developed well by a club leave when entering their prime.

That said, it's not the greatest loss if he leaves IF we get a good first round pick and can bring someone good in.

I'm not sure how many would play Jenkin's role as well, but although he's huge, he's not the contested beast that Tippett was and I'm not too sure how it would affect our structure.

My main issue would be who would give Sauce a chop out in the ruck? Ruck forwards who are effective are rare. JJ's ruck work has improved considerably over the past few years. It could put a hole in our team which, while small, is unfillable.
